What Belts and Hoses Actually Do

Belts transfer force from the crankshaft to accessories like the alternator and compressor, while hoses carry coolant between the radiator and engine. A worn belt can slip or snap, and a cracked hose can leak or burst under pressure. Why They Break Down Over Time

Heat, contamination, and constant tension cause rubber to harden and lose flexibility. Oil leaks and debris accelerate wear, while age weakens internal fibers. When to Replace and What to Check

Inspection intervals usually fall between 30,000 and 60,000 miles, though harsh conditions can shorten that range. Watch for squealing sounds, visible cracks, or coolant residue near hose connections. Replacing belts and hoses alongside a worn water pump can prevent repeat labor costs. FAQ: Belts and Hoses

How long do belts and hoses last?
Most last between 30,000 and 60,000 miles, depending on driving conditions and maintenance habits.

What are common signs of failure?
Squealing noises, cracks, leaks, or visible wear are early indicators that replacement is needed.
